GO-FLOW法在产品装配过程可靠性分析中的应用
Application of GO-FLOW methodology in reliability analysis of product assembly process

Abstract
Based on the theory of reliability engineering, GO-FLOW methodology was employed to analyze the reliability of product assembly process. The common model diagram of product assembly process controlled by reliability was established through analysis of relationship between multi-step processes. The example of assembly process of gear oil pump was provided to establish its GO-FLOW chart and analyze its signals, operators and calculation rules. GO-FLOW algorithm was performed to determine the failure probability and reliability of signals, so as to find out the key that affected the reliability of product assembly process. The result shows that GO-FLOW methodology is simple and useful in reliability analysis of product assembly process.关键词
